Position Profile
This role provides individualized quality care to patients (bathing, grooming and personal care) and develops personal connections that support both patient and family.
Home care aides work under the supervision of a registered nurse and are part of an interdisciplinary home care team. Care delivery primarily takes place in the patient's home or in a facility where the patient receives care.

Hospice of the Valley is a recognized leader in hospice care, committed to setting the standard of excellence for end-of-life care. We serve patients and families in central Arizona, including Maricopa and northern Pinal counties. Since our founding in 1977, our mission has remained the same: bringing comfort and dignity as life nears its end. Hospice of the Valley, one of the nation's largest not-for-profit hospices, is known for innovative programs and clinical excellence, including: - 24/7 on-duty carenever an answering service. - Arizona Palliative Home Care, which serves patients with lat...e-stage chronic illnesses who arent on hospice but could be soon. - Award-winning clinical staff and leadership. - Education programs that teach professionals and the public about quality end-of-life care. - Individualized care and support to specific communities, including veterans, Hispanics and faith groups.
